2. The Core Mechanics – How the Grid Works

The heart of Sugar Rush casino is its seven rows by seven columns of candy symbols. At the start of each round, the grid is filled with random icons ranging from lollipops and gummy bears to star‑shaped sweets and heart‑shaped treats. Once you press spin, the symbols lock into place until the tumble cycle begins.

A cluster win triggers removal of the matching icons, which then fall downwards from above to fill gaps—just like beads sliding into a new row. Because new symbols can immediately create fresh clusters, you often see several wins stacked on top of each other in rapid succession.

  • Five or more identical symbols trigger a win.
  • Winning cells disappear and new ones drop from the top.
  • Cascading wins can occur until no further clusters form.

3. Multipliers That Build Sweetly

One of the most exciting parts of this slot is the multiplier spot feature. When a cluster lands on an already marked spot, the multiplier on that cell doubles—starting at twofold and potentially climbing up to one hundred twenty‑eight times the base amount.

Because the multiplier applies only when new clusters land directly above an existing marked spot, skilled players often aim for repeat wins on high‑value symbols such as pink lollipops or orange hearts that pay up to one hundred fifty times the stake when they form large clusters.

  • Multiplier starts at 2× and doubles with each successive win.
  • Maximum multiplier capped at 128×.
  • All wins landing on marked spots receive added multiplier value.

4. Free Spins – The Sweetest Feature

Triggering free spins is as simple as spinning three or more rocket gumball machine scatter symbols across the grid. Depending on how many scatters appear—between three and seven—you earn between ten and thirty free spins.

During this round, all previously marked spots stay active and continue accumulating multipliers with each successive tumble cycle. That means if you’re lucky enough to land several big clusters in a row, you could see your returns skyrocket without needing another bet.

  • 3 scatters = 10 free spins.
  • 4 scatters = 12 free spins.
  • 5 scatters = 15 free spins.
  • 6 scatters = 20 free spins.
  • 7 scatters = 30 free spins.
